Bonding Basics
In covalent bonding, both atoms are trying to attract
electrons--the same electrons. Thus, the electrons are shared
tightly between the atoms. The force of attraction that each atom exerts on the
shared electrons is what holds the two atoms together.
| The shared electrons of a covalent bond can be
represented using Lewis diagrams. The bond can be emphasized by using a
line to "hold the atoms together." The electron dots that are not involved in
the bond are sometimes shown and sometimes not shown. |
